Output 3129d954f67996430d63b0cc23a2e3305394619f7be370f0f46ea626eea2f89a:1

value
17732432
script pubkey
OP_0 OP_PUSHBYTES_20 3f5312a61a09cc8b57b8abc9190f7bb77738f1a2
address
ltc1q8af39fs6p8xgk4ac40y3jrmmkamn3udzs6qdew
transaction
3129d954f67996430d63b0cc23a2e3305394619f7be370f0f46ea626eea2f89a
spent
true